...This was a dolls house i got for £8 from a car boot. It was made made from ply by a grandad for his grandaughter. When i got it the whole thing was painted in just 1 coat of white emulsion and has geen windows. I used homebase 'classic cream' matt emulsion (one of my favourites) and a baby pink which i got from Crown. It was a custom mix that the person never collected so i got the tin for £2.50. The leopard is fablon, which took ages to source, and the black carpet is an off cut from my dining room. I sold this on ebay in the end as i needed the space, but i wish i hadn't, because not only have i had another baby girl, but this is really useful for storage. Can be used as a book shelf, bedside storage etc...ho hum! Plenty more where that came from...
